问题
单项选择题
已知“借阅”表中有“借阅编号”、“学号”和“借阅图书编号”等字段,每名学生每借阅一本书即生成一条记录,要求按学生学号统计出每名学生的借阅次数,下列SQL语句中,正确的是______。
A.SELECT学号,COUNT(学号)FROM借阅
B.SELECT学号,COUNT(学号)FROM借阅GROUP BY学号
C.SELECT学号,SUM(学号)FROM借阅
D.SELECT学号,SUM(学号)FROM借阅ORDER BY学号
答案
参考答案:B
解析: SQL查询中分组统计使用Group by子句,统计次数使用合计函数count(),据此题要求按学号统计学生借阅次数使用的查询语句为SELECT学号,COUNT(学号) FROM借阅GROUP BY学号,所以选项B正确。